Opinion

PER CURIAM.

The parties have filed a joint motion to dismiss. The parties’ joint motion is granted. Tex.R.App.P. 59(a)(1)(A).

The judgment of this Court, dated July 12, 1995, is withdrawn; the judgment of the trial court is vacated and the cause dismissed in accord with the settlement agreement of the parties. The majority and dissenting opinions of this Court dated July 12,1995, are not withdrawn.
